Possible disadvantages of HTML PDF API

  • Cost
    Depending on your usage, HTML PDF API can become expensive, particularly for large-scale operations requiring high volume or premium features.
  • Dependency on Internet Connectivity
    Being a cloud-based service, it requires a stable internet connection, which can be a limitation in environments with poor connectivity.
  • Latency
    Network latency can affect the speed of PDF generation, which may impact time-sensitive applications.
  • Rate Limiting
    Usage may be subject to rate limiting, potentially hindering the performance of high-demand applications or requiring additional cost to increase limits.
  • Privacy Concerns
    Sensitive data needs to be transmitted to a third-party server for processing, which could raise privacy and compliance concerns depending on jurisdiction and data sensitivity.
  • Potential Downtime
    As with any cloud-based service, there is a risk of downtime or service disruptions due to server issues or maintenance.

PDFBridge.xyz features and specs

  • Ghost Mode
    For sensitive documents, enable Ghost Mode by passing "ghostMode": true. The PDF will be generated, streamed to your webhook, and instantly deleted from our processing infrastructure.
  • Intelligent PDF Analysis
    PDFBridge uses high-performance intelligent engines to automatically analyze and extract structured JSON data from your generated PDFs. Perfect for auto-tagging, data entry automation, and content summarization.
  • Tailwind-Native
    PDFBridge features native support for Tailwind CSS. You can use any utility classes directly in your HTML payloads without manually linking stylesheets or configuring complex build pipelines.
  • Bulk Conversion
    Process up to 1,000 conversions in a single request. Highly efficient for generating large sets of documents like monthly invoices.
  • Dynamic Templates
    PDFBridge supports dynamic content injection using Handlebars-style variables. You can define placeholders like {{name}} in your HTML and provide values at conversion time.
  • Team Management
    Collaborate with your team seamlessly. Invite members, manage roles, and share templates across your organization.

What's the story behind your product?

PDFBridge.xyz's answer:

PDFBridge was born out of frustration. Our founding team spent years "babysitting" fragile Puppeteer and wkhtmltopdf clusters that would inevitably crash on "Invoice Day." We decided to build the engine we always wanted: one that handles the messy complexities of the modern web (Tailwind, React, heavy JS) while remaining stateless, secure, and incredibly fast.
